一、请回望第一次作业,你对于软件工程课程的想象
1)对比开篇博客你对课程目标和期待,“希望通过实践锻炼,增强计算机专业的能力和就业竞争力”,对比目前的所学所练所得,在哪些方面达到了你的期待和目标,哪些方面还存在哪些不足,为什么?
- 大致了解软件工程的内容,对这门课没什么期待。内容丰富,没有明显的不足。
- 感觉软件工程大部分内容重复又无聊,还有不停的改动需求。这门课程坚定了以后不当一个码农的心。
2)总结这门课程的实践总结和给你带来的提升,包括以下内容:
1、统计一下,你在这门软件工程实践中,完成了多少行的代码;
- 个人编程代码量:500+
- 结对编程代码量:500+
- 团队编程代码量:500+
- 合计:1500+
2、软工实践的各次作业分别花了多少时间?
编号 | 作业名称 | 时长(分钟) |
---|---|---|
1 | 个人编程 | 450 |
2 | 结对编程 | 500 |
3 | 团队项目需求分析 | 150 |
4 | 现场编程 | 250 |
5 | alpha编程 | 800 |
6 | beta编程 | 1000 |
3、哪一次作业让你印象最深刻?为什么?
alpha编程,做到一半软件因为不兼容崩了,然后安装各个版本的软件,把C盘塞满了。
4、累计花了多少个小时在软工实践上?平均每周花多少个小时?同时贴出开篇博客“你打算平均每周拿出多少个小时用在这门课上”的回答
- 没有概念,几十个小时吧。平均的话可能有5个小时。
- 我不会拿出很多时间在这门课上,原本想找个大佬带我躺的,可惜大佬们不收FW。555,。不过还是会做好分内的事。(一开始的回答)
- 比我想象中多花了不少时间。
5、学习和使用的新软件;
unity3d
6、学习和使用的新工具;
github
7、学习和掌握的新语言、新平台;
C#
8、学习和掌握的新方法;
没学到啥新方法
9、其他方面的提升。
对于用尽量少的知识,做尽量多的功能这一能力有了提高。
二、写下属于自己的人月神话——个人或结对或团队项目实践中的经验总结+实例/例证结合的分析
- 结对编程的时候,当时还不会java不过因为不会用c++的网络连接,不得已用java的,不过用c++的格式写,发现差不多。写了一晚上,就把原来c++的代码改成java了,功能也没啥问题。
三、这学期下来,你最感谢的人是谁?有什么话想要对TA说呢?
感谢ljj,后面受不了直接把我的活甩给他了,不过他也没啥意见。